Default Smelly Clutch

Hi, I am new to this forum but have enjoyed similar ones with BMW.

My wife has a 97 A4 we bought new and now has about 95K miles. She is a good driver of stick shift, doesn't ride her foot on the clutch, etc.

This week she started to notice a hot smell that does smell like the clutch. She also complained it doesn't shift well. This seems to happen when the car is warm. So far the clutch doesn't slip and it runs well when cold.

Our regular mechanic looked at it and said it seems OK but he will drive it more. He also said he has two other customers who had similar complaints but no real problems.

Anyone out there ever heard of this or had similar issues???
